Gyakori hiba:
Learners sometimes use 'fellow' for women, but in this meaning it almost always refers to males.
Jelentés
A man or boy

Gyakori hiba:
Learners sometimes confuse this with 'friend', but 'fellow' here means someone sharing a situation, not necessarily a close personal relationship.
Jelentés
Person in same group

Gyakori hiba:
Learners may confuse 'fellow' here with 'friend'; in this sense it is an official title or role.
Jelentés
Member of learned society
Szókapcsolatok
research fellow |university fellow |fellow of the Royal Society
Szinonimák
member (General term for someone belonging to a group; less specific than 'fellow' in this context.)
Témák
education |professional |work
Definíció

A senior member of a university or professional group, often with special duties or honors.

A senior member of a college, university, or professional organization, often with special responsibilities or honors.

Kifejezések

fellow feeling

1
/fˈɛloʊ fˈilɪŋ/
fixed phrase

Shared sympathy or understanding

A feeling of sympathy or understanding that you share with someone else.

Példák
  • There was a sense of fellow feeling among the volunteers.
  • She felt a strong fellow feeling with the refugees.

good fellow

1
/ɡˈʊd fˈɛloʊ/
fixed phrase

Kind, pleasant man

A man who is friendly and nice to others.

Példák
  • He's a good fellow, always ready to help.
  • Everyone agreed that Tom was a good fellow.

my fellow man

1
/mˈaɪ fˈɛloʊ mˈæn/
fixed phrase

Other people in general

Other people in the world, not including yourself.

Példák
  • We must care for our fellow man.
  • He dedicated his life to helping his fellow man.
